comparemela.com
Home
Naveen Pereira
Top Locations Tagged with Naveen Pereira
Naveen Pereira in United States - 55905/Physicians-surgeons near Olmsted
1). Doctor Naveen L Pereira, Md, St St Sw
vimarsana © 2020. All Rights Reserved.